Each employee required to be on-site must receive an individual worker permit. Victorians who need to travel to work will need to have a worker permit with them or face individual fines of $1,652. Employers can issue a worker permit to their employee if: the organisation is on the list of permitted activities the employee is working in an approved category for on-site work, and the employee cannot work from home. When unexpected shift changes occur, a worker needs to continue to carry their existing worker permit to enable authorities to verify with the employer that the worker is on their way to or from work. A permitted worker permit can be shown electronically to authorities such as a photo, or scanned copy, or on a mobile device. Permitted Worker Scheme From 11:59pm on Sunday 8 November 2020, businesses no longer need to issue permits to workers who are travelling between metropolitan Melbourne and regional Victoria for work.
